I've tried so many things to get this stupid paint off the floor.  Besides the obvious of scrapping and scrubbing.  I've tried paint thinner, magic eraser, WD40, vinegar.  Nothing works.  My mom told me to get "Oops".  But of course we don't have that in the south, so I've got to try to find something else that'll work.
